0x80070002 Windows 7 Backup Error | The System Cannot Find The File Specified

You may get the error, Backup encountered a problem while backing up file C:\Windows\System32\config\systemprofile\Podcasts. Error:(The system cannot find the file specified. (0x80070002)). This error may be caused after a windows update. How to correct this backup error?

As said before this error may have caused from an Windows Update. And not really, this can also occur if the library is reporting the path of this folder incorrectly and hence the issue. As a workaround, please do the following:
  1. Change backup settings
  2. Select the same target device
  3. Let me choose
  4. Expand the user nodes from the tree view to see which user has the "Podcasts" library.
  5. Deselect the library.
  6. If you want the contents of this library to get backed up, please select the actual path of the folder (ex: C:\Users\bench3\Podcasts) from the Computer section in the tree view.
  7. Save settings.
This will exclude the problematic library from your backup settings and the next backup should be GREEN. Please try this workaround if you are coming across the error 0x80070002
